Transaction e9380ad26a73a11f4dbea52c87ca01b379f424c99eea4ba45f29dcf9e7a493ef

1 Input
2 Outputs
  • e9380ad26a73a11f4dbea52c87ca01b379f424c99eea4ba45f29dcf9e7a493ef:0
  • value  7552480
    address  1BhqfufRfPuojcd3woFXsMa7VLhi1uZhys
  • e9380ad26a73a11f4dbea52c87ca01b379f424c99eea4ba45f29dcf9e7a493ef:1
  • value  2429864410
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c